What is the Gear S2 Classic?

The gear s2 classic is a circular smartwatch that emphasizes a traditional watch silhouette while delivering smart functionality. It uses a rotating bezel for navigation and pairs with compatible mobile devices to bring notifications, weather, calendar reminders, and basic apps to your wrist. This model was designed to appeal to shoppers who value aesthetics as much as performance. In practice, users interact primarily through the bezel, with touch input available for precise actions. The gear s2 classic demonstrates how a smartwatch can blend classic styling with practical usability, making it a compelling option for those who want a wearable that looks like a timepiece first and acts like a smart assistant second.

Display and Navigation

The Gear S2 Classic uses a circular display with a bezel-driven navigation system. The bezel allows fast scrolling through apps, notifications, and settings, which many users find more intuitive than on square or rectangular screens. The display is designed to be legible in daylight and responsive to touch when needed. This combination makes it easy to glance at time and notifications, then dive into details with a quick twist of the bezel. For most daily tasks, the bezel acts as the primary input method, with touch input reserved for selecting items or typing short messages. The result is a user experience that feels both familiar and modern.

Battery Life and Charging

Battery life on gear s2 classic varies with usage, but the design aims to offer at least a day of typical use with normal notifications, fitness tracking, and occasional GPS assistance. Heavier notification load or frequent GPS usage can shorten the cycle, while lighter days may extend it. Charging is straightforward, usually through a compact dock or cradle that makes it easy to drop the watch in place at night. If you need longer endurance for extended trips, expect roughly a day to a day and a half with moderate use. Real-world results depend on screen brightness, alert frequency, and how often you interact with apps.
